This study describes the length-weight relation (LWR) of small indigenous fish Pethia ticto from Gomti River, Aamghat, Haliyapur, Sultanpur district 260 29N and 810 44E, 751m (msl) Uttar Pradesh, India. A total of 306 specimens were caught by random sampling method using traditional fishing gear as gillnet, cast net and dragnet of various mesh sizes from June 2016 to May 2017, once in a month. Total Length (mm) was measured from anteriormost part of the snout to the posterior-most part of the caudal fin and body weight (g) were taken by digital electronic balance. The analysis of data shows that the allometric coefficient is close to isometric value (3.0). Allometric growth indicates a more rotund population of fish when the values of growth coefficient are higher than 3.0 (b>3). If the value of growth coefficient is less than 3.0, the population of fish is known to be less rotund. Isometric growth indicates that the shape of fish does not change as it grows (b=3). The coefficient of determination (R2 ) was also found significant (=0.97). Fulton’s condition factor further supports the results obtained ranged from 1.041 to 1.660 shows the degree of well being of a fish. This study is helpful in providing relevant information in the assessment of stock and estimation of the fish condition about its environment

The hilsa shad <em>Tenualosa ilisha</em> (Hamilton, 1822), is a commercially important and highly relished food fish. This paper presents the length-weight relationships (LWR) and condition factor of hilsa, throughout its geographical distribution in India. A total of 910 samples of <em>T. ilisha</em>, comprising 404 males and 288 females collected from various locations of east and west coasts of India were used for analyses. Heterogeneity in the LWR of males, females and pooled population was noticed. The regression coefficient (b) ranged from 2.07-3.68 for pooled, 0.75-3.03 for males and 1.78-2.97 for females. The coefficient of determination (R2) varied between 0.72-0.98 in pooled, 0.73-0.94 in males and 0.76-0.97 in females. Fulton’s condition factor (K) ranged from 0.47-3.05 in pooled, 0.47-1.63 in male and from 0.77-3.05 in female samples whereas relative condition factor (Kn) varied from 0.48-2.51 in pooled population, from 0.47-1.56 in males and 0.76-2.33 in females. Mean Fulton’s condition factor (K) ranged from 0.7-1.33 in pooled population, 0.92-1.28 in males and from 0.95-1.39 in females whereas the mean relative condition factor (Kn) varied between 0.98-1.04 in pooled population, 0.98-1.04 in males and 0.98-1.03 in females. These parameters (b, K, Kn) have been found useful in evaluating the well-being of different populations of this species. Most of the populations under study showed concordance to ideal value of b, thereby indicating isometric growth. However, significant negative allometric growth was observed for pooled samples from Padma, Hoogly and males from Padma and significant positive allometric growth was observed in the pooled samples collected from Hoogly. Comparative study of recent data with the decadal old data (1999-2000) revealed differences in mean size of the fish. This study also indicates overexploitation of the species in the recent years, which might be due to intensive fishing efforts.

Length-weight relationships (LWRs) and condition factor are important biological information to assess the growth pattern and wellbeing of fish species influenced by numerous abiotic and biotic factors. To date, no data on the LWRs and condition of mullets in Sombreior River, Niger Delta. Hence, this research was conducted to determine abundance, length–weight relationship and Fulton’s condition factor (K) of three species of fish belonging to family Mugilidae in Sombreior River, Nigeria. There were a total of 248 samples from five sampling stations for a period of months. Fish species were of various sizes ranging from 24.66±0.40 to 26.35±0.26cm in length and 141.41±6.30 to 161.56±5.87g in weight. For the three species, slope (b) values ranged from 2.18 to 2.68 indicating a negative allometric growth of all fish species. The mean condition factor ranged from 0.89±0.03 forsix Mugil cephalus to 0.93±0.03 for Parachelon grandisquamis while the coefficients of determination (R2) of the LWR regressions ranged between 0.64 (Neochelon falcipinnis) and 0.79 (Parachelon grandisquamis). It was concluded that the mullets in the Sombreior River had a negative allometric growth pattern and the condition is showing the species were in good state of well-being since mean K values are  greater than 1.

Aim: The study aimed to investigate the morphometric and meristic measurements, length-weight relationship and relative condition factor of Odonus niger landed along coastal Karnataka. Methodology: The morphometric and meristic measurements, length-weight relationship and relative condition factor (Kn) of O. niger was studied for a period of eight months from August 2019 to March 2020. The different morphometric characters were subjected to statistical analysis. The length-weight relationship was analyzed for both the sexes (female and male) and combined data. Monthly relative condition factor was analyzed for both the sexes and for different size group. Results: A comparison of different morphometric measurements exhibited good extent of correlation indicating good extent of interdependence of these characters. Four out of eight morphometric characters are environmentally controlled and suggested wide range of zoogeographical distribution of O. niger. The length-weight relationship is indicated as W = 0.046 L2.565, W = 0.044 L2.589 and W = 0.047 L2.561 with coefficient of determination (r2) of 0.910, 0.913 and 0.910 for male, female and combined sexes, respectively. The 'b' values of both the sexes (male and female) exhibited negative allometric growth (p<0.05) and appeared to be leaner. There was no significant (p<0.05) variation for relative condition factor (Kn) among the months and size groups. However, little higher values were observed during November and February. Interpretation: The study fills the knowledge gap and support for developing a suitable management system for this fish species.

The study aims to figure out growth pattern and condition factor of the flying fish (Decapterus russelli) landed at the Fish Landing Base Tenda, Hulonthalangi District, Gorontalo City. Sampling of 360 layang fish was carried out randomly based on a simple random sampling method for three months. Determination of fish sex was conducted visually by dissecting samples and observing the gonads. The study showed that the layang fish (D. russelli) landed in PPI Tenda had a positive allometric growth pattern with condition factor values ranging from 1.005 to 1.014 and 1.002 to 1.620 for male and female, respectively

The present study was carried out to investigate some aspects of the biology of Oreochromis niloticus, it has ecological and economic importance, found in Khashm El-Girba market; here, we describe the length-weight relationships, condition factors and sex ratio of O. niloticus.  A total of 525 specimens were collected from August to November 2016. This study indicated that; the regression of length against weight was computed from the relationship W= a Lb; growth coefficient (b) value 2.880 ±0.430 less than 3, which indicate have negative allometric growth. The condition factors (K) is 3.866 ± 0.027; While the sex ratio was (M: F) 1:0.98.

Assessment of length-weight relationship (LWR), length-length relationship (LLR) and condition factor was carried out for Bangana dero in northeastern India, mainly from the Brahmaputra and Irrawaddy (Manipur) River system.  We report a value of ‘b’ 3.1269 and 3.1426 for LWR with respect to total length and standard length respectively, indicating positive allometric growth. The value of ‘b’ for LLR is less than one, which indicates that growth in total length is less with per unit increase in standard length.  The value of ‘K’ and ‘Kn’ is 0.91 and 0.72 depicts normal well being of fish in its habitat.

The knowledge of length-weight relationship parameters has numerous practical applications in fishery research and management. Currently, there is a dearth of information on the growth pattern and state of well-being of Parachanna africana in Ijede and Agbowa Lagoons. This study period was between December 2017, and June 2018 investigated the allometry and condition factor of P. africana inhabiting the Ijede and Agbowa Lagoons, South-western Nigeria. Two hundred fish samples of P. africana was gotten from fishermen at both locations. The length and weight measurements were taken to the nearest centimetres and grams. Descriptive, correlation and regression tools, was used to 2analyse the data collected. Results obtained showed that the length-weight relationship had r values of  0.186, 0.196, 0.191 and 0.341, 0.001, 0.098 for Ijede and Agbowa respectively, at a significant level of  P<0.05 for male, female and combined sexes. The b values of 0.193 for Ijede and 0.165 for Agbowa were not significantly different (P> 0.05). The mean condition factors of 0.365 ±0.141 and 0.329±0.169 were obtained in Ijede and Agbowa, respectively. It was observed that the species in both lagoons exhibited negative allometric growth patterns with values 0.365 and 0.330 for Ijede and Agbowa lagoons respectively with no variations in the condition factors of both locations which indicate the need to assess human and domestic activities surrounding these water bodies.

Aims: The Tanoe-Ehy swamp forest (TESF) is a freshwater swampy area characterized by seasonal variation of environmental parameters and fish diversity. So, the aim of this study was to analyze seasonal variations of growth parameters and condition factors of the three abundant species. Methodology: Specimens were collected by using gill nets and fyke nets, measured and weighed. Length-weight relationship (LWR), Fulton’s condition (KF) and relative condition (KR) factors were analyzed from Standard Length (SL) and body weight (BW). Results: The Standard Length of Clarias buettikoferi, Thysochromis ansorgii and Parachana obscura varied between 9.50 and 29.30 cm, 4.60 and 11.50 cm, 10.70 and 29.30 cm, respectively. The growth type of population was allometric negative for C. buettikoferi and P. obscura and isometric for T. ansorgii. In terms of seasonal variation, C. buettikoferi females and P. obscura specimens exhibited isometric growth in dry seasons (DS) against a negative allometric growth in flooded seasons (FS). In contrast, female and combined sex specimens of T. ansorgii showed positive allometric growth in DS and isometric growth type in FS. KR varied between 0.76 and 2.02 and was significantly higher in FS than in DS, indicating a state of well-being during flooded seasons in the 3 species. Conclusion: There was a significant relationship between length with weight and both condition factor for the three species. This study provided the first data about fish body measurements in the TESF and concluded that LWRs and condition factors of the three fish species were strongly influenced by seasonal variations in hydrological conditions.

Langkumbe River is located in West Kulisusu District and has long been used by the community for various daily activities. One of the resources often used by the people around Langkumbe River is pokea clams. The aim of this study was to determine the production and biomass of pokea clams (B. violacea) in Langkumbe River Waters of North Buton Regency from August to October 2017. The sampling method used was swept area method using a traditional fishing gear "Tangge" (fishing gear). The samples were measured for the length, width and thickness.  The total weight was measured with the clam/total mass (MT) and the weight of the meat. The samples were dried using an oven for 24 hours at 70 °C to obtain the shell-free dry mass (SFDW). Data were analyzed using standard formulas. The total sample obtained was 1.307 individuals. The highest density of pokea clam was found in August at 596.8 ind/m². Annual production of pokea clam (B. violacea) in Langkumbe River with a total annual production of 1,107.33 gSFDW/m2/year. The highest and lowest production are 297.09 gSFDW/m²/year at size 2.19-2.54cm and -0.16 gSFDW /m²/year at size 4.70-5.05cm, respectively. The total population biomass was 528.03 gSFDW/m2 with the highest biomass 171.72 gSFDW/m²/year at size 2.55-2.90 cm and the lowest was 1.40 gSFDW /m²/year at size 4.70-5.05 cm, so that the recovery rate (P/B ratio) was 2.1 gSFDW/m2/year.

The role of the family has the influence to overcome all obstacles both from internal and external students in realizing all the ideals and hopes. Family support can increase learning motivation, sense of security and attention of students who are still in school. The form of family expression through empathy and acceptance helps students with enthusiasm to manifest individual enthusiasm in the learning process. High learning motivation is also caused by school well-being which is used by school institutions to understand all the basic needs for students and hope that individuals feel satisfaction, well-being and comfort in school with all the processes so as to reduce low learning motivation, this makes students feel prosperous, happy, happy in studying at school. This study aims to determine the effect of family support and school well-being on learning motivation in students of SMP Negeri 1 Telukjambe Timur Karawang. The number of samples used was 205 students of SMP Negeri 1 grades 7 and 8 East Telukjambe using probability sampling method. Based on the multiple regression analysis test that there is an influence between family support and school well-being on the learning motivation of students of SMP Negeri 1 Telukjambe Timur Karawang grades 7 and 8 with a Sign value. 0.000 <0.005, which means that family support and school well-being affect students' learning motivation by 23.1%.
